How Trackium Works
System Architecture
Trackium operates on a three-layer architecture: Device Layer, Node Layer, and Blockchain Layer. Each layer plays a critical role in ensuring security, decentralization, and data ownership.
Device Layer
The physical Trackium device captures GPS coordinates, movement data, and environmental sensors. It communicates via LTE Cat-M1/NB-IoT and processes data locally before transmitting to your personal Minima node.
Minima Node Layer
Your Minima node (mobile or desktop) receives encrypted data from the device. It processes movement proofs, manages encryption keys, and prepares blockchain transactions. All data stays on YOUR device - no central servers.
Blockchain Layer
Proof-of-Movement transactions are submitted to Minima blockchain every 5 minutes (customizable). Each proof is cryptographically signed, timestamped, and immutable. Anyone can verify the authenticity of your tracking data.
Device Layer
The Trackium device is built on Raspberry Pi Zero 2W with modular components for different environments.
Hardware Components
Raspberry Pi Zero 2W
SIM7000E LTE Cat-M1/NB-IoT Module
Ublox NEO-6M GPS Module
5000mAh Li-Po Battery
Optional Solar Panel
Accelerometer & Gyroscope
Communication
LTE Cat-M1 (Low power, global coverage)
NB-IoT fallback
End-to-end encryption (TLS 1.3)
Direct connection to your Minima node
No intermediary servers
Offline mode with local buffering
Power Management
Optimized for 6+ months battery life
Solar charging option
Sleep mode between tracking intervals
Low-power LTE connection
Battery health monitoring
Remote power diagnostics

Blockchain Layer
Proof-of-Movement
Every 5 minutes (customizable or on-demand), your node creates a cryptographic proof containing GPS coordinates, timestamp, and device signature. This proof is submitted to Minima blockchain as a transaction.
Transaction Structure
Each proof contains: Device ID (hashed), GPS coordinates (encrypted), timestamp, cryptographic signature, and optional metadata. Proofs are batched to minimize blockchain fees.
Verification
Anyone can verify your tracking proofs using the blockchain explorer. Proofs are tamper-proof and cannot be altered retroactively. Perfect for insurance claims, customs documentation, and legal evidence.
